About 8-[(3R,4R)-3-[[1-hydroxy-2-(1-methylpiperidin-3-yl)ethyl]amino]-4-methylpyrrolidin-1-yl]quinoxaline-5-carbonitrile

8-[(3R,4R)-3-[[1-hydroxy-2-(1-methylpiperidin-3-yl)ethyl]amino]-4-methylpyrrolidin-1-yl]quinoxaline-5-carbonitrile (PubChem CID 155297123) has the molecular formula C22H30N6O and a molecular weight of 394.52 g/mol. Its IUPAC name is 8-[(3R,4R)-3-[[1-hydroxy-2-(1-methylpiperidin-3-yl)ethyl]amino]-4-methylpyrrolidin-1-yl]quinoxaline-5-carbonitrile.
